{"product_id":"pillar-base-yixing-clay-woodfired-teapot-94816","title":"Pillar base yixing clay woodfired teapot # 94816","description":"The exact term \"柱础壶\" (literally \"pillar‑base teapot\") is not a standard, widely recorded historical category in major ceramic catalogs, so its precise canonical details are ambiguous. The name, however, clearly evokes an architectural motif — the stone or wooden block (柱础) that supports a column — and the design is best understood as a teapot whose silhouette references that element.\u003cbr\u003e\r\n\u003cbr\u003e\r\nHistorically, Chinese teapot forms have often borrowed from everyday and architectural objects; Yixing and studio potters from the late Ming through modern periods experimented with geometric and found‑object shapes. A pillar‑base inspired form would sit within that long tradition of object‑inspired design: functional, sculptural, and emphasizing material and proportion over applied ornament.\u003cbr\u003e\r\n\u003cbr\u003e\r\nShape note: expect a compact, generally cylindrical or slightly truncated columnar body with straight or subtly flared sides, a flat or gently domed lid that aligns with the top plane, and simple spout and handle that balance the vertical mass. Surface treatment is typically restrained — plain clay, subtle burnish, or minimal carving — to keep attention on the columnar geometry and proportion.\u003cbr\u003e\r\nWood-fired handmade Yixing teapot made from Duanni clay sourced from the original Huanglongshan mine.
